Types of Glass Used in Replacement

Before diving into the replacement process, it is essential to comprehend the types of glass that can be used for various applications. Different types serve different purposes, and each has distinct attributes.

Kind of GlassAttributesTypical Uses
Annealed GlassStandard glass, cut to sizeWindows, interior partitions
Tempered GlassHeat-treated for added strengthShower doors, glass doors
Laminated GlassTwo or more layers of glass bonded with a plastic interlayerSkylights, shatterproof glass
Low-E GlassCoated to show heat and UV raysEnergy-efficient windows
Double GlazingTwo panes with an area in between for insulationWindows in cold environments
Acrylic/PlexiglassLightweight and shatter-resistantIndications, screens, and security guards

The Glass Replacement Process

Replacing glass may appear simple, however it involves cautious preparation, execution, and safety preventative measures. Below is a detailed guide to the glass replacement process.

Step 1: Assessment

Examine the broken glass to figure out the type and extent of damage. Inspect if the frame is also damaged, as this might impact the replacement procedure.

Step 2: Gather Tools and Materials

Collect the essential tools, such as:

  • Safety goggles and gloves
  • Glass cutter (if cutting glass)
  • Measuring tape
  • Putty knife
  • Silicone sealant
  • Wood strips for support (if required)
  • New glass pane

Step 3: Remove the Broken Glass

  • Carefully remove any staying fragments of glass from the frame.
  • Utilize a putty knife to pry out old glazing putty or remove any metal clips holding the glass in place.

Step 4: Prepare the Frame

  • Clean the frame to remove particles, dust, and old putty.
  • Make sure the surface is smooth; repair any broken areas if necessary.

Step 5: Measure and Cut New Glass

  • Measure the frame's measurements accurately.
  • If the glass needs to be cut, utilize a glass cutter to score the surface before breaking along ball game line.

Action 6: Install New Glass

  • Place the new glass pane into the frame, guaranteeing it fits comfortably.
  • Use glazing putty or silicone sealant to protect the glass in location, filling any spaces.

Action 7: Final Touches

  • Tidy the glass surface area to get rid of any finger prints or spots.
  • Enable the sealant to cure as per maker's guidelines, usually 24-48 hours.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Just how much does glass replacement cost?

The cost of glass replacement can vary widely based on numerous factors, consisting of the type of glass, the size of the pane, and labor expenses. Usually, house owners can expect to pay in between ₤ 100 and ₤ 300 per pane, including installation.

2. Can  repairmywindowsanddoors  change glass myself?

Yes, replacing glass can be a DIY task if you have the essential tools and skills. Nevertheless, for larger or more complex tasks, hiring a professional is a good idea.

3. How long does it require to replace glass?

The time required for glass replacement can vary; an easy window replacement might take a couple of hours, while bigger commercial tasks might need several days.

4. What types of glass are best for energy effectiveness?

Low-E glass and double glazing are the very best choices for energy effectiveness. They assist show heat and UV rays, lowering energy costs.

5. How typically should I change glass in my home?

There is no set timeframe for glass replacement, however you need to examine doors and windows regularly for fractures or damage. Replace glass as quickly as damage is noted to keep energy performance and safety.
